In photovoltaic mode. Maximum linear current specifies the level at which the output current characteristic deviates more than 10% from the
straight line. The short circuit current saturates at approximately 10 times this level.
Response Time (transition time between 10% and 90% of the output signal amplitude) measured at 670 nm with a 50Ω load. Shorter wavelengths
will result in faster rise and fall times.
Storage and Operating Temperature Range for all photodiodes is -40°C to 110°C, except for the SD 225-23-21-040, which is –25°C to 100°C.
